They weren't too laggy for me, but since the ear piece doesn't cup the ear, every time I would push the Lesche in the earth the sudden movement from my body would cause the overly heavy headband to fall forward.
Sometimes the WR700's would fall completely off.

The dongle is huge so using the inline volume control is recommended to avoid plugging the jack directly into the detector in addition to controlling the volume.
I mounted mine with Velcro but the design requires mounting to the battery cover. Ergo if the dongle is bumped, the cover pops open and it falls apart and dangles by the cord.

Lastly, the WR700's powers down after 3 minutes of no audio, so if your detector has no audible threshold and you are in a clean area or cherry picking, they will shut down on you without any indication.
You could be swinging for a while thinking there are no targets. Needless to say, mine are in the pile of stupid purchases.
